96SEO 2026-06-15 06:05 7
嘿,老友们,咱今天聊点实用的!想知道 MySQL 到底有多少种日志,以及 redo、undo、binlog 这仨到底啥关系吗?别担心,我来给你捋一捋,保证你听完得心安理得。要说 MySQL 日志,那可不少啊。常见的包括错误日志 、查询日志 、慢查询日志 、事务日志 ,还有二进制日志 和通用日志 。不过真正核心的还是那几项。想想kan,MySQL 数据库要Zuo到数据持久化、事务回滚和主从复制,这几项dou是必不可少的。

先说说 MySQL 的主要日志类型吧:
错误日志 : 记录数据库运行过程中发生的错误信息。遇到问题排查时这个文件是关键。
查询日志 : 记录所有执行过的 SQL 查询语句。Ke以用于分析用户行为或性Neng瓶颈。
慢查询日志 : 只记录执行时间超过阈值的 SQL 查询语句。帮助找出性Neng较差的 SQL 语句。
事务日志 : 用于记录事务的开始和结束状态,以及对数据页的修改操作。这是实现数据持久化和崩溃恢复的基础。
二进制日志 : 记录所有对数据库数据的修改操作。主要用于主从复制和数据恢复。
通用日志 : 在 MySQL 5.7.6 及geng早版本中存在记录所有客户端连接信息等一般性信息。
redo、undo、binlog 的区别好了接下来咱们重点聊聊 redo log, undo log 和 binlog 这仨的区别吧。
Redo LogRedo log 是 InnoDB 存储引擎独有的特性之一. 它就像一个“备份”系统. 当一个事务提交后, 会先将修 入 redo log, 然后再写入数据文件. Ru果在写完 redo log 后, 系统发生崩溃, 重启后, InnoDB 会使用 redo log 来恢复数据文件的状态. 所以 redo log 主要用于保证数据的持久性和一致性.
记住一句: **Redo Log 就是用来Zuo“重Zuo”的!**
Undo LogUndo log 的作用是实现事务的回滚功Neng和并发控制机制. 当一个事务需要回滚时, 会使用 undo log 来撤销之前对数据的修改. 同时, undo log 也被用于生成多版本并发控制的快照. 所以 undo log 主要用于保证数据的可恢复性和并发安全性.
记住一句: **Undo Log 就是用来Zuo“回滚”的!**
BinlogBinlog 是 MySQL Server 层记录的所有对数据库数据的修改操作. 它就像一个“历史记录”系统. 主服务器将所有的修改操作写入 binlog 文件中, 然后通过主从复制将 binlog 同步到从服务器上. Binlog 主要用于实现主从复制和数据恢复.
记住一句: **Binlog 就是用来Zuo“归档”的!**
三种逻辑关系| 特性 | Redo Log | Undo Log | Binlog |
|---|---|---|---|
| 适用引擎 | InnoDB | InnoDB | 所有引擎 |
| 主要作用 | 崩溃恢复 | 事务回滚/MVCC | 主从复制/数据恢复 |
| 写入顺序 | 先写后刷 | 先写后刷 | 追加写入 |
哎呀,这个问题问得好! 其实我以前也纠结过这个问题。 为什么百度不收录呢?
其实原因可Neng有hen多:原创度不高: Ru果你的文章内容没有特别高的原创性或者与搜索引擎算法要求不符的话
关键词密度过高: 过度堆砌关键词可Neng会被视为作弊行为
内部链接结构不合理: Ru果你的网站内部链接结构不够清晰流畅
其他因素: 可Neng你的网站存在其他违反搜索引擎规则的问题等等……
理解了 redo log 的作用是保证数据的持久性和一致性;
理解了 undo log 的作用是实现事务的回滚功Neng和并发控制;
理解了 binlog 的作用是实现主从复制和数据恢复;
熟悉这三种日志之间的区别和联系; Ke以根据实际情况灵活运用它们来优化数据库性Neng或解决问题。
.作为专业的SEO优化服务提供商,我们致力于通过科学、系统的搜索引擎优化策略,帮助企业在百度、Google等搜索引擎中获得更高的排名和流量。我们的服务涵盖网站结构优化、内容优化、技术SEO和链接建设等多个维度。
| 服务项目 | 基础套餐 | 标准套餐 | 高级定制 |
|---|---|---|---|
| 关键词优化数量 | 10-20个核心词 | 30-50个核心词+长尾词 | 80-150个全方位覆盖 |
| 内容优化 | 基础页面优化 | 全站内容优化+每月5篇原创 | 个性化内容策略+每月15篇原创 |
| 技术SEO | 基本技术检查 | 全面技术优化+移动适配 | 深度技术重构+性能优化 |
| 外链建设 | 每月5-10条 | 每月20-30条高质量外链 | 每月50+条多渠道外链 |
| 数据报告 | 月度基础报告 | 双周详细报告+分析 | 每周深度报告+策略调整 |
| 效果保障 | 3-6个月见效 | 2-4个月见效 | 1-3个月快速见效 |
我们的SEO优化服务遵循科学严谨的流程,确保每一步都基于数据分析和行业最佳实践:
全面检测网站技术问题、内容质量、竞争对手情况,制定个性化优化方案。
基于用户搜索意图和商业目标,制定全面的关键词矩阵和布局策略。
解决网站技术问题,优化网站结构,提升页面速度和移动端体验。
创作高质量原创内容,优化现有页面,建立内容更新机制。
获取高质量外部链接,建立品牌在线影响力,提升网站权威度。
持续监控排名、流量和转化数据,根据效果调整优化策略。
基于我们服务的客户数据统计,平均优化效果如下:
我们坚信,真正的SEO优化不仅仅是追求排名,而是通过提供优质内容、优化用户体验、建立网站权威,最终实现可持续的业务增长。我们的目标是与客户建立长期合作关系,共同成长。
Demand feedback